OpenStructure
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
Public Member Functions | Static Public Member Functions | Data Fields | Static Public Attributes
VisibilityOp Class Reference

Public Member Functions

def __init__
def GetName
def SetSelection
def GetSelection
def SetVisible
def SetSelectionFlags
def GetSelectionFlags
def IsVisible
def ApplyOn
def ToInfo

Static Public Member Functions

def FromInfo

Data Fields

 selection_
 visible_
 flags_

Static Public Attributes

string VISIBLE_ATTRIBUTE_NAME = "Visible"
string FLAGS_ATTRIBUTE_NAME = "Flags"

Detailed Description

Definition at line 25 of file visibility_op.py.


Constructor & Destructor Documentation

def __init__ (   self,
  selection,
  flags,
  visible = False 
)

Definition at line 29 of file visibility_op.py.


Member Function Documentation

def ApplyOn (   self,
  entity 
)

Definition at line 55 of file visibility_op.py.

def FromInfo (   group)
static

Definition at line 65 of file visibility_op.py.

def GetName (   self)

Definition at line 34 of file visibility_op.py.

def GetSelection (   self)

Definition at line 40 of file visibility_op.py.

def GetSelectionFlags (   self)

Definition at line 49 of file visibility_op.py.

def IsVisible (   self)

Definition at line 52 of file visibility_op.py.

def SetSelection (   self,
  selection 
)

Definition at line 37 of file visibility_op.py.

def SetSelectionFlags (   self,
  flags 
)

Definition at line 46 of file visibility_op.py.

def SetVisible (   self,
  visible 
)

Definition at line 43 of file visibility_op.py.

def ToInfo (   self,
  group 
)

Definition at line 59 of file visibility_op.py.


Field Documentation

flags_

Definition at line 32 of file visibility_op.py.

string FLAGS_ATTRIBUTE_NAME = "Flags"
static

Definition at line 27 of file visibility_op.py.

selection_

Definition at line 30 of file visibility_op.py.

visible_

Definition at line 31 of file visibility_op.py.

string VISIBLE_ATTRIBUTE_NAME = "Visible"
static

Definition at line 26 of file visibility_op.py.


The documentation for this class was generated from the following file: